¶ Menm epòk sa a, yon gwo foul moun te sanble ankò. Yo pa t' gen anyen pou yo manje. Jezi rele disip li yo, li di yo konsa:

-Kè m' fè m' mal pou moun sa yo. Sa fè twa jou depi yo la avè m', yo fin manje tou sa yo te pote.

Si m' voye yo al lakay yo konsa san manje, y'a tonbe feblès nan chemen paske gen ladan yo ki soti byen lwen.

Disip li yo reponn li: -Nan dezè sa a, ki bò poun jwenn pen pou plen vant tout moun sa yo?

Jezi mande yo: -Konbe pen nou gen la a? Yo reponn: -Nou gen sèt pen.

Lè sa a, li fè foul moun yo chita atè; li pran sèt pen yo; li di Bondye mèsi, li kase yo an moso, li renmèt yo bay disip li yo pou yo mache bay tout moun. Disip yo mache bay tout moun pen.

Te gen kèk ti pwason la tou. Jezi di Bondye mèsi pou yo tou, li mande disip li yo mache bay tout foul moun yo.

Tout moun te manje vant plen. Yo plen sèt panyen pote ale avèk moso ki te rete.

Te gen katmil (4.000) moun konsa antou. Apre sa, Jezi voye yo ale.

10 ¶ Touswit apre sa, li moute nan kannòt la avèk disip li yo, li ale nan yon peyi yo rele Dalmanouta.

11 Farizyen yo vin rive. Yo tanmen diskite avèk Jezi: yo te vle pran li nan pèlen. Yo mande l' pou l' fè yon mirak ki pou moutre se Bondye ki ba li tout pouvwa sa a.

12 Jezi bay yon gwo soupi nan kè l', li di yo konsa: -Poukisa moun alèkile yo renmen mande mirak konsa? Se vre wi sa m'ap di nou la a: yo p'ap jwenn okenn mirak.

13 Apre sa, li vire do l' ba yo, li tounen nan kannòt la; li pati pou lòt bò lanmè a.

14 Men, disip yo te bliye pran lòt pen: yo te gen yon sèl grenn pen avè yo nan kannòt la.

15 Jezi ba yo lòd sa a: -Fè atansyon. Pran prekosyon nou avèk ledven farizyen yo ansanm avèk ledven Ewòd la.

16 Disip yo pran pale pou kont yo, yonn t'ap di lòt: -Se paske nou pa gen pen kifè l' di nou sa.

17 Jezi vin konnen sa yo t'ap di konsa. Li mande yo: -Poukisa n'ap di: se paske nou pa gen pen? Se konnen nou pa konnen? Nou poko ka konprann toujou? Se bouche lespri nou bouche konsa?

18 Gen lè nou pa wè nan je nou? Nou pa tande nan zòrèy nou? Se bliye nou gen tan bliye?

19 Lè m' te separe senk pen bay senkmil (5,000) moun yo, konbe panyen plen moso nou te pote ale? Yo reponn li: -Douz panyen.

20 Jezi mande yo anko: -Lè m' te separe sèt pen bay katmil (4.000) moun yo, konbe panyen plen moso nou te pote ale? Yo reponn li: -Sèt panyen.

21 Lè sa a li di yo: -Nou pa konprann toujou?

22 ¶ Apre sa, y' ale Betsayda. Yo mennen yon nonm avèg bay Jezi. Yo mande li pou l' te manyen li.

23 Jezi pran men avèg la, li mennen l' soti nan bouk la. Li pran ti gout krache, li mete nan je avèg la. Apre sa, li mete men l' sou tèt avèg la: Li mande li: -Eske ou wè kichòy?

24 Avèg la louvri je l', li di: -Mwen wè moun k'ap mache; yo sanble pyebwa.

25 Jezi remete men l' ankò nan je l' yo. Lè sa a, avèg la wè klè nèt. Li te geri, li te wè tout bagay klè.

26 Jezi voye l' al lakay li, li di l' konsa: -Pa antre nan bouk la.

27 ¶ Jezi pati apre sa avèk disip li yo; li ale nan tout bouk ki te nan rejyon Sezare Filip la. Antan yo t'ap mache, li poze yo keksyon sa a: -Ki moun yo di mwen ye en?

28 Yo reponn li: -Gen moun ki di se Jan Batis ou ye. Gen lòt ki di ou se Eli; gen lòt ankò ki di ou se yonn nan pwofèt yo.

29 Li mande yo ankò: -Bon, nou menm, ki moun nou di mwen ye? Pyè reponn li: -Ou se Kris la.

30 Lè sa a, Jezi ba yo lòd byen sevè pou yo pa di pèsonn sa.

31 Apre sa, li kòmanse di disip li yo yon bann bagay. Li di yo konsa: -Mwen menm, Moun Bondye voye nan lachè a, mwen gen pou m' soufri anpil. Chèf fanmi yo, chèf prèt yo, dirèktè lalwa yo, yo yonn p'ap vle wè mwen. Y'ap fè touye m'. Men sou twa jou, mwen gen pou m' leve soti vivan pami mò yo.

32 Li t'ap pale konsa aklè ak yo. Pyè rele l' sou kote, li di li: -Pa pale konsa non.

33 Men Jezi vire tèt li, li gade disip li yo. Li pale sevè ak Pyè, li di li konsa: -Wete kò ou sou mwen, Satan! Paske, lide ou pa sou sa Bondye vle, men sou sa lèzòm ta vle.

34 Lè sa a Jezi rele foul moun yo ansanm avèk disip li yo, li di yo konsa: -Si yon moun vle mache dèyè m', se pou l' bliye tèt li, se pou l' chaje kwa l' sou zepòl li epi swiv mwen.

35 Paske, moun ki ta vle sove lavi l' va pèdi li. Men, moun ki va pèdi lavi l' poutèt mwen ak bon nouvèl la, li va sove li.

36 Kisa sa ta sèvi yon moun pou li ta genyen lemonn antye si l' pèdi lavi li?

37 Ou ankò, kisa yon nonm kapab bay pou l' gen lavi?

38 Si yon moun wont di se moun mwen li ye, si li wont pale pawòl mwen nan mitan bann moun alèkile yo ki vire do bay Bondye pou viv nan peche, enben, mwen menm tou, Moun Bondye voye nan lachè a, lè m'a tounen avèk zanj Bondye yo nan tout bèl pouvwa Papa m' lan, m'a wont pran li pou moun pa m' tou.

Jesus Feeds the Four Thousand(A)(B)(C)

During those days another large crowd gathered. Since they had nothing to eat, Jesus called his disciples to him and said, “I have compassion for these people;(D) they have already been with me three days and have nothing to eat. If I send them home hungry, they will collapse on the way, because some of them have come a long distance.”

His disciples answered, “But where in this remote place can anyone get enough bread to feed them?”

“How many loaves do you have?” Jesus asked.

“Seven,” they replied.

He told the crowd to sit down on the ground. When he had taken the seven loaves and given thanks, he broke them and gave them to his disciples to distribute to the people, and they did so. They had a few small fish as well; he gave thanks for them also and told the disciples to distribute them.(E) The people ate and were satisfied. Afterward the disciples picked up seven basketfuls of broken pieces that were left over.(F) About four thousand were present. After he had sent them away, 10 he got into the boat with his disciples and went to the region of Dalmanutha.

11 The Pharisees came and began to question Jesus. To test him, they asked him for a sign from heaven.(G) 12 He sighed deeply(H) and said, “Why does this generation ask for a sign? Truly I tell you, no sign will be given to it.” 13 Then he left them, got back into the boat and crossed to the other side.

The Yeast of the Pharisees and Herod

14 The disciples had forgotten to bring bread, except for one loaf they had with them in the boat. 15 “Be careful,” Jesus warned them. “Watch out for the yeast(I) of the Pharisees(J) and that of Herod.”(K)

16 They discussed this with one another and said, “It is because we have no bread.”

17 Aware of their discussion, Jesus asked them: “Why are you talking about having no bread? Do you still not see or understand? Are your hearts hardened?(L) 18 Do you have eyes but fail to see, and ears but fail to hear? And don’t you remember? 19 When I broke the five loaves for the five thousand, how many basketfuls of pieces did you pick up?”

“Twelve,”(M) they replied.

20 “And when I broke the seven loaves for the four thousand, how many basketfuls of pieces did you pick up?”

They answered, “Seven.”(N)

21 He said to them, “Do you still not understand?”(O)

Jesus Heals a Blind Man at Bethsaida

22 They came to Bethsaida,(P) and some people brought a blind man(Q) and begged Jesus to touch him. 23 He took the blind man by the hand and led him outside the village. When he had spit(R) on the man’s eyes and put his hands on(S) him, Jesus asked, “Do you see anything?”

24 He looked up and said, “I see people; they look like trees walking around.”

25 Once more Jesus put his hands on the man’s eyes. Then his eyes were opened, his sight was restored, and he saw everything clearly. 26 Jesus sent him home, saying, “Don’t even go into[a] the village.”

Peter Declares That Jesus Is the Messiah(T)

27 Jesus and his disciples went on to the villages around Caesarea Philippi. On the way he asked them, “Who do people say I am?”

28 They replied, “Some say John the Baptist;(U) others say Elijah;(V) and still others, one of the prophets.”

29 “But what about you?” he asked. “Who do you say I am?”

Peter answered, “You are the Messiah.”(W)

30 Jesus warned them not to tell anyone about him.(X)

Jesus Predicts His Death(Y)

31 He then began to teach them that the Son of Man(Z) must suffer many things(AA) and be rejected by the elders, the chief priests and the teachers of the law,(AB) and that he must be killed(AC) and after three days(AD) rise again.(AE) 32 He spoke plainly(AF) about this, and Peter took him aside and began to rebuke him.

33 But when Jesus turned and looked at his disciples, he rebuked Peter. “Get behind me, Satan!”(AG) he said. “You do not have in mind the concerns of God, but merely human concerns.”

The Way of the Cross

34 Then he called the crowd to him along with his disciples and said: “Whoever wants to be my disciple must deny themselves and take up their cross and follow me.(AH) 35 For whoever wants to save their life[b] will lose it, but whoever loses their life for me and for the gospel will save it.(AI) 36 What good is it for someone to gain the whole world, yet forfeit their soul? 37 Or what can anyone give in exchange for their soul? 38 If anyone is ashamed of me and my words in this adulterous and sinful generation, the Son of Man(AJ) will be ashamed of them(AK) when he comes(AL) in his Father’s glory with the holy angels.”
